Arts council’s Estevan Concert Series cancelled

The Estevan Arts Council has announced the cancellation of the 2020-21 Estevan Concert Series.

The Organization of Saskatchewan Arts Council’s (OSAC) board and staff, after consulting with the membership and other stakeholders, have made the difficult decision to cancel the entire 2020-21 performing arts season.

“The safety of our volunteers, venue employees, audience members and artists from across the country is paramount and it became obvious that a season of over 170 performances in nearly 40 communities would not be possible,” OSAC said in a post on its Facebook page.  

OSAC thanks everyone involved for being understanding during these challenging times and the organization looks forward to “Bringing the Arts to You” again in the fall of 2021.

After consultation with school boards throughout the province, OSAC has also cancelled the entire performing arts in school season for the 2020-21 school year with the goal of rescheduling those performances in future school years. It brings performances to schools through the province each year.

The visual arts program Arts on the Move remains active, bringing exhibits to art galleries in Saskatchewan.
